在滚动事件停止后发生的事件是"滚动停止事件"。滚动停止事件是指当用户停止滚动页面或滚动容器时触发的事件。它可以用于执行一些需要在滚动停止后进行的操作,例如加载更多内容、更新页面元素、触发动画效果等。
滚动停止事件的触发可以通过监听滚动事件,并使用一定的延迟机制来判断滚动是否停止。一种常见的实现方式是使用定时器,在滚动事件触发后启动一个定时器,若在一定时间内没有再次触发滚动事件,则可以认为滚动已经停止。
在前端开发中,可以使用JavaScript来实现滚动停止事件的监听和处理。以下是一个简单的示例代码:
var scrollTimer;
window.addEventListener('scroll', function() {
clearTimeout(scrollTimer);
scrollTimer = setTimeout(function() {
// 在滚动停止后执行的操作
console.log('滚动已停止');
}, 200); // 设置延迟时间,单位为毫秒
});
在滚动停止后,可以根据具体需求进行相应的操作。例如,可以通过AJAX请求加载更多数据,更新页面内容,或者执行其他自定义的逻辑。
腾讯云提供了丰富的云计算产品和服务,其中与滚动停止事件相关的产品可能包括云函数(Serverless)、云存储(COS)、内容分发网络(CDN)等。具体的产品选择和使用方式可以根据实际需求进行评估和决策。您可以访问腾讯云官网(https://cloud.tencent.com/)了解更多关于腾讯云的产品和服务信息。
领取专属 10元无门槛券
手把手带您无忧上云